WebThe clearance envelope is typically defined by the transit authority where the vehicles will be operated. In the case where the transit authority does not have a well-defined clearance envelope, general application envelopes exist from alternative standards. AREMA provides clearance envelopes for standard mainline railroad vehicles, and APTA ... WebThe difference between these two gauges is called the clearance. The specified amount of clearance makes allowance for wobbling of rail vehicles at speed or the shifting of …
